Google Test主页:http://code.google.com/p/googletest/教程:http://code.google.com/p/googletest/wiki/V1_6_Documentation断言ASSERT_* 一旦失败立即退出当前函数,EXPECT_*还能继续下去。基础断言致命断言非致命断言验证
转载
2021-06-28 16:13:16
623阅读
我用VS2008: 1. 打开msvc里面的工程文件sln,直接batch build all。 2. 在msvc里面的Debug或是Release目录里看到编译出来的gtestd.lib或是gtest.lib 文件。 3. 设置include和libaray文件。(Tools--options--
转载
2010-04-09 10:03:00
68阅读
现在常用的C++单元测试框架有 CppUnit,CxxTest,boost::test和google test。不像java/C#的测试框架,由于C++不支持reflection,所以,必须
转载
2009-03-15 20:58:00
50阅读
gtest 代码目录结构说明:以 gtest-1.7.0 为例cmake, codegear, make, msvc, xcode构建测试项目的构建文件,如 make 就是 Makefile.To
原创
2023-09-14 17:51:38
277阅读
TODO: 全局环境和监听事件在运行过程中的顺序。 https://gitee.com/boluanace/googletest/blob/master/googletest/test/googletest-listener-test.cc 参考资料 https://github.com/googl
google test 简称gtest,是一个C/C++的单元测试框架,它的代码在 "github仓库" ,使用起来还是挺方便的。 安装 先确保PC上有安装cmake: 如果没有安装cmake,可以安装一下: 我的机子14.04安装的是2.8.12.2版本的cmake,注意记一下你的版本号,下面有用
转载
2018-03-18 12:14:00
286阅读
2评论
A:题意密码由n不同的字符和m的长度组成,问你有多少种情况
解题思路:可以得到状态转移方程为 dp[i][j] = dp[i-1][j]*j + dp[i-1][j-1]*(n-j+1);
解题代码:
1 // File Name: a.cpp
2 // Author: darkdream
3 // Created Time: 2014年09月15日 星期一 14时29分39秒
4
转载
2014-09-15 16:22:00
67阅读
2评论
Google Test1. 自定义错误输出:ASSERT_EQ(x.size(), y.size()) "Vectors x a
原创
2023-06-15 13:56:54
1733阅读
1. https://github.com/google/googletest (google的测试框架) 2. eclipse测试框架插件 https://github.com/xgsa/cdt-tests-runner/wiki/Tutorial
转载
2017-12-13 11:03:00
110阅读
2评论
gtest 用法1 将gtest-1.5.0解压,拷贝gtest-1.5.0.zip\gtest-1.5.0\include下的gtest 到 include 目录下 添加包含库目录为 include2 将gtestd.lib拷贝到当前项目的lib目录下 ,链接库依赖项 添加 lib3 链接器 输入 附加依赖项gtestd.lib
原创
2022-11-08 14:07:27
121阅读
Google Test 缺省是出错退出。如果最后的出错行在au
原创
2023-06-15 22:15:06
99阅读
题目链接:
http://code.google.com/codejam/contest/5214486/dashboard
Problem A. Minesweeper
题目意思:
扫雷。告诉地雷所在的位置,求至少须要几步,把全部的非雷位置都翻过来。假设某一个格子周围都不是地雷。则翻转该格子会把周围的格子都翻转过来。
解题思路:
dfs找连通块
先把非雷格子周围的地雷总数求出,然后对于周
转载
2017-08-02 19:53:00
156阅读
2评论
谷歌校招笔试的练习赛,题目很简单,应该只是用来熟悉环境的题目链接A - Bad Horse 题意 有一些人,并且告诉一些二元关系,表示哪对人是不能属于一个组
原创
2022-08-12 14:07:48
63阅读
今天手感还算不错,出了三个题,也有不顺的时候,要不第四题水个小数据或许可以混进前100。
原创
2022-08-12 15:06:32
38阅读
文章目录一、googleTest测试框架的基本介绍1.基本概念2.断言3.基本断言判断4.二元比较运算符5.字符串比较二、
原创
精选
2023-03-12 14:37:03
1325阅读
简介我们做app开发时,大部分都是要上传到第三方的市场的,那么在上传到像google这种比较特殊的市场的时候,我们在程序内怎么做版本更新判断呢?假如你的app有自己的后台服务,那还可以用后台服务器做版本判断,那对于没有服务的同学来说该怎么办呢?下面我们就来说说这种没有后台服务器的解决办法。检测版本更新对于google play市场我们要怎么检测版本更新呢?google 没有提供直接的api或者比较